We use a F150 2WD with a 351 for farm use. It is well worn, but does a good job of hauling stuff. I think I pushed it too hard and was wondering if anyone thinks I could fix it reasonably $, or would I be better off sending it down the road.
I had hauled 2 previous loads of cob corn in gravity boxes, with additional (avg) of 7700#. 3rd load was 7860. All three loads, I had to pull over and hook a tractor up to pull me up this last part of a steep hill.
Now going into this hauling, I knew the truck wasn't running in tip top shape, seems to be missing a bit when you get on it. But it is still running fine, problem lies in tranny.
Right at the spot I pulled over and waited for daughter to come with tractor and I had shut it off to wait is where I find the puddle of transmission fluid started. When I start up the truck it is pouring out, and from as close as I can see, it looks to be coming from inbetween the torque converter and housing. If I am wrong on terminology forgive me, I don't work on vehicles much
Anybody have an educated guess what it wrong? Is there a seal in there that could of blown? or any type of hyd hoses? Transmission is still working (except for fluid running out like crazy).
